Type
ORACLE
Validation date
2025-10-14 05:21: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 3.416e-4,
    "usd": 3.957e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001AE9DE4459CE48AE85F8BF5103AFB15DB071C48405E77560156C9260B84F534DF

Previous signature

E23B61A07464FFC2D4C34BB0AAD450D40568D7DE1CAAE361ADCBDA7AC5AC5F3949889269F3A3CBFDC62226A87070D40F1C557C87F3D9F118FCD9EDC9A999AB06

Origin signature

304402203BF23CCDA05EC86EFF1E3F9C111ADABDC668016DEE6EADFE2D36FFD8A08330CE02200A0A33CD48BE26EB2FFA12CB63301549051254E3BF3A985F2A150A01B6A2DA07

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00309F01F3AC85638D4C13128BE4230ABF6687C5F9B5D04C0D2F0A01DD8A80E854

Coordinator signature

93FE9BED4EBF0593FAF468C951601AAA2FB0773E4DAAAB46C6D9DB4B2B37FA8BA60AAE2AEFF4E568558C748AD1E887DD44EB915C48300746C0C98EF21BE8D806

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

4FB1437D5DC1FC6F9D0741403F6DAEC0932D375A08A6AE73874F6F7D1A8DE616754032D75006810787AEA3A5F79E77CDA61891934671D2A511FD468F8D1A6F00

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

BEAD094212A2FBE710FC53D0C92FEEFEEE70FFE3F6A767F524ADA2E325C1FC0B9A36F2EA85FE59964CC7FB40B31606E5241538DE26D9A08F2ED925950C174D0F